Coal paucity threatens 15,000 MW power projects

The shortage of coal may adversely affect the new capacity addition plans in power sector to the tune of 15,000 MW in the current fiscal. Coal availability for power plants designed to run on indigenous coal would be only 417.5 mn tonne in the current fiscal,as against the requirement of 480 mn tonne. The Ministry of Power has stated that it will now supply 319 mn tonne to power sector.

KBL Expands Kaniyur Facility in Centenary Year

Kirloskar Brothers (KBL), a leading player in fluid management solutions, has inaugurated a new factory building at its Kaniyur Manufacturing Facility in Tamil Nadu. The expansion coincides with a milestone year marking 100 years since the company manufactured and installed India’s first centrifugal pump in 1926. The newly commissioned facility is aimed at enhancing productivity and operational efficiency, enabling the company to address rising domestic as well as international demand while upholding stringent quality benchmarks. CPCL Ranks No.1 in NHAI DPR Ratings

"Chaitanya Projects Consultancy (CPCL) has secured the top position in National Highways Authority of India’s first-ever provisional DPR consultants rating, scoring 80.75 out of 100 and outperforming 55 peer firms.CPCL ranked ahead of Pentacle Consultants (78), L&T Infrastructure Engineering (76), MSV International Technology (74) and Transys Consulting (72).
